...that in 1800 ether was first used by partyers as a fun diversion? Sniffing the gas led to hilarious and raucous laughter as people watched each other become more and more intoxicated and silly. Several doctors independently realized the value ether would have to anesthetize surgery patients. Of those who claimed rights to the "discovery," none had a happy ending. One had a seizure and died defending his rights. Another spent his life in an asylum because he had been denied acclaim. A third became addicted to chloroform and, in a New York City jail, he soaked a cloth in the drug, severed an artery and bled to death.
Make the Most of Our Site
See this month's Top Inventors and Most Cited Patents.
Stay on top of the latest innovations by subscribing to an RSS feed.
Registered users: Manage your profile.
| Number | Title | Issue Date |
| 8184798 | Methods, systems and computer program products for accessing number portability (NP) and E.164 number (ENUM) data using a common NP/ENUM data locator structure According to one aspect, the subject matter described herein comprises methods, systems, and computer program products for accessing number portability (NP) and E.164 number (ENUM) data in a combined NP/ENUM database. One method includes receiving a query including ... | 05/22/2012 |
| 8179895 | Methods, systems, and computer program products for monitoring tunneled internet protocol (IP) traffic on a high bandwidth IP network Methods, systems, and computer program products for monitoring tunneled Internet protocol (IP) traffic on a high bandwidth IP network are disclosed. According to one method, a copy of a tunneled IP packet traversing an IP communications network is generated. The pac... | 05/15/2012 |
| 8179885 | Methods, systems, and computer program products for organizing, managing, and selectively distributing routing information in a signaling message routing node Methods, systems, and computer program products for managing and selectively distributing routing information in a routing node are disclosed. In one implementation, a method for selectively distributing routing information in a routing node includes organizing inte... | 05/15/2012 |
| 8149725 | Methods, systems, and computer program products for a hierarchical, redundant OAM&P architecture for use in an IP multimedia subsystem (IMS) network Methods, systems, and computer program products for a hierarchical, redundant OAM&P architecture for use in an IP multimedia subsystem (IMS) are disclosed. According to one aspect, the subject matter described herein includes a system for managing an Internet protoc... | 04/03/2012 |
| 8139562 | Scalable call processing node A scalable call processing node includes link interface modules capable of processing n calls per second and call server modules capable of processing m calls per second, n is variable relative to m by changing the relative numbers of call server and link interface ... | 03/20/2012 |
| 8090850 | Methods, systems, and computer readable media for regulating network address translator (NAT) and firewall pinhole preservation traffic in a session initiation protocol (SIP) network Methods, systems, and computer readable media for regulating pinhole preservation traffic generated or received by firewall or network address translator (NAT) session initiation protocol (SIP) user agent clients (UACs) are disclosed. One method includes, maintainin... | 01/03/2012 |
| 8073127 | Methods, systems, and computer program products for using a location routing number based query and response mechanism to effect subscriber cutover A method for using an LRN based query and response mechanism to effect subscriber cutover includes receiving an LRN based response message including a communications service subscriber identifier. The method further includes determining a cutover switch LRN associat... | 12/06/2011 |
| 8059667 | Methods, systems, and computer program products for applying multiple communications services to a call Methods, systems, and computer program products for providing an enriched messaging service in a communications system is described. In one embodiment, the method includes receiving a signaling message associated with a call at one of a plurality of service dispatch... | 11/15/2011 |
| 8050253 | Methods, systems, and computer program products for decentralized processing of signaling messages in a multi-application processing environment Disclosed are methods, systems, and computer program products for decentralized triggerless processing of signaling messages in a multi-application processing environment. According to one method, a signaling message is received at a screening module. At least one a... | 11/01/2011 |
| 8045983 | Methods systems, and computer program products for providing internet protocol multimedia subsystem (IMS) services in response to advanced intelligent network (AIN) triggers The subject matter described herein relates to methods, systems, and computer program products for providing Internet protocol multimedia subsystem (IMS) services in response to advanced intelligent network (AIN) triggers. According to one aspect, a method for provi... | 10/25/2011 |
| 8041021 | Methods, systems, and computer program products for selecting a global title translation mode based on an originator of a signaling message and performing global title translation according to the selected mode The subject matter disclosed herein includes methods, systems, and computer program products for selecting among different global title translation modes based on a message originator and performing global title translation based on the selected mode. According to o... | 10/18/2011 |
| 7996541 | Methods, systems, and computer program products for identifying a serving home subscriber server (HSS) in a communications network Methods, systems, and computer program products for determining a serving home subscriber server (HSS) in a communications network are described. One method includes obtaining a subscriber identifier from a query message. An exceptions-based data structure contained... | 08/09/2011 |
| 7996024 | Method for preventing the delivery of short message service message spam Methods, systems, and computer program products for delivery of SMS messages are disclosed. According to one method, first routing data for delivery of an SMS message to a mobile terminal is received at a network element. Second routing data is transmitted from the ... | 08/09/2011 |
| 7996007 | Methods, systems, and computer program products for routing a call from a 2G network to a dual mode 2G/session initiation protocol (SIP) device Methods, systems, and computer program products for routing a call from a 2G network to a dual mode 2G/session initiation protocol (SIP) device are disclosed. According to one method, a 2G mobility location information query message requesting mobility location info... | 08/09/2011 |
| 7983245 | Methods and systems for converting an internet protocol (IP)-based message containing subscriber content to a public switched telephone network (PSTN)-based message including subscriber content A node in a converged network converts a session initiation protocol (SIP) message to a signaling system 7 (SS7) message. A SIP INVITE request is received by the node and the node determines whether the SIP INVITE request is destined for an SS7 user. If the INVITE r... | 07/19/2011 |
| 7961622 | Methods, systems, and computer program products for monitoring and analyzing signaling messages associated with delivery of streaming media content to subscribers via a broadcast and multicast service (BCMCS) Methods, systems, and computer program products for analyzing signaling messages associated with delivery of streaming media content to subscribers via a broadcast and multicast service (BCMCS) are disclosed. According to one method, at least one signaling message t... | 06/14/2011 |
| 7936866 | Methods, systems, and computer program products for processing mobile originated query messages for prepaid mobile subscribers in a number portability environment Methods, systems, and computer program products for routing query messages associated with prepaid subscribers in a number portability environment are disclosed. One method may include sending a registration message to an HLR. At the HLR, the ID or address of an STP... | 05/03/2011 |
| 7933608 | Methods, systems, and computer program products for providing presence gateway functionality in a telecommunications network A method for providing presence gateway functionality includes deriving presence information for subscribers in a first set of subscribers based on telecommunications signaling messages. The first set of subscribers includes at least one subscriber who is not a subs... | 04/26/2011 |
| 7929419 | Methods, systems, and computer program products for inhibiting message traffic to an unavailable terminating SIP server Methods, systems, and computer program products for inhibiting message traffic to an unavailable terminating SIP server are disclosed. According to one method, at least one list of SIP servers accessible by a call session control function (CSCF) is maintained at an ... | 04/19/2011 |
| 7916857 | Methods, systems, and computer readable media for selectively processing or redirecting signaling connection control part (SCCP) messages The subject matter described herein includes methods, systems, and computer program products for selectively processing or redirecting SCCP messages. According to one method, an SCCP message addressed to an STP and sent route-on-PC-SSN is received at the STP. It is ... | 03/29/2011 |
| 7916685 | Methods, systems, and computer program products for supporting database access in an internet protocol multimedia subsystem (IMS) network environment Methods, systems, and computer program products for supporting database access in an Internet protocol (IP) multimedia subsystem (IMS) network environment are disclosed. At least one call state control function (CSCF) entity generates subscriber-related queries acco... | 03/29/2011 |
| 7912486 | Methods, systems, and computer program products for surveillance of messaging service messages in a communications network Methods, systems, and computer program products for surveillance of messaging service messages in a communications network are disclosed. According to one aspect, a system is provided for intercepting a messaging service message in a communications network. The syst... | 03/22/2011 |
| 7907713 | Methods, systems, and computer program products for using a presence database to deliver enhanced presence information regarding communications made to or from a presentity Methods, systems, and computer program products for using a presence database to deliver enhanced presence information regarding communications made to or from a presentity are disclosed. According to one aspect, a method may include obtaining enhanced presence info... | 03/15/2011 |
| 7907533 | Methods, systems, and computer program products for performing IP link proving using heartbeat messages According to one aspect, the subject matter described herein comprises methods, systems, and computer program products for performing IP link proving using heartbeat messages. The method includes transmitting a plurality of heartbeat messages over an IP communicatio... | 03/15/2011 |
| 7889716 | Methods, systems, and computer program products for using an E.164 number (ENUM) database for message service message routing resolution among 2G and subsequent generation network systems Methods, systems, and computer program products for using an E.164 number (ENUM) database for message service message routing resolution among 2G and subsequent generation network systems are disclosed. According to one method, a message including message service me... | 02/15/2011 |
| 7848767 | Methods and systems for migrating between application layer mobile signaling protocols Methods and systems for migrating between application layer mobile signaling protocols are disclosed. For subscribers of multiple protocols, the registration status is tracked in one or more of the protocols. When a location query message for a subscriber of multipl... | 12/07/2010 |
| 7864943 | Methods and systems for load sharing and preserving sequencing of signaling connection control part (SCCP) messages Methods and systems for load sharing and preserving sequencing of signaling connection control part (SCCP) messages are disclosed. According to one method, SCCP messages are received at an inbound interface module and assigned a sequence number. Each SCCP message is... | 01/04/2011 |
| 7864665 | Methods and systems for detecting IP route failure and for dynamically re-routing VoIP sessions in response to failure Methods and systems for detecting IP route failure using a request-reply protocol, such as address resolution protocol (ARP), and for dynamically re-routing VoIP sessions in a VoIP device in response to failure of an IP route are disclosed. A plurality of IP routes ... | 01/04/2011 |
| 7861056 | Methods, systems, and computer program products for providing memory management with constant defragmentation time Methods, systems, and computer program products for providing memory management with constant defragmentation time are disclosed. According to one aspect, the subject matter described herein includes a method for memory management. The method includes dividing memor... | 12/28/2010 |
| 7860799 | Methods, systems, and computer program products for providing media content delivery audit and verification services Methods, systems, and computer program products for providing media content delivery audit and verification services are disclosed. In one example, a monitoring system analyzes messages associated with communications in a wireless communications network. The monitor... | 12/28/2010 |
| 7856094 | Methods, systems, and computer program products for providing telecommunications services between a session initiation protocol (SIP) network and a signaling system 7 (SS7) network Methods, systems, and computer program products for providing telecommunication services between a SIP network and an SS7 network are disclosed. In one method, SIP/SS7 gateway receives an INVITE message from a SIP proxy server. The SIP/SS7 gateway extracts a called ... | 12/21/2010 |
| 7853784 | Filtering and application triggering platform A filtering and application triggering platform may be implemented on a signaling message routing node to decode signaling messages and increase efficiency in subsequent processing of the signaling message. A communications link module on a signaling message routing... | 12/14/2010 |
| 7853707 | Methods and systems for extensible link level alignment between modules in a distributed processing system Methods and systems for link-level alignment between processing modules or cards and distributed processing system are disclosed. According to one method, cards that support link level communications parameter negotiation exchange link status signal units (LSSUs) to... | 12/14/2010 |
| 7844033 | Methods, systems, and computer program products for generic call tracing Methods, systems, and computer program products for performing a trace of a communications transaction using a dynamically generated endpoint identifier list are disclosed. According to one method, a first endpoint identifier for identifying a communications endpoin... | 11/30/2010 |
| 7839889 | Methods and systems for communicating signaling system 7 (SS7) user part messages among SS7 signaling points (SPs) and internet protocol (IP) nodes using signal transfer points (STPs) Methods and systems for transmitting user part messages between signaling system seven (SS7) signaling points over an internet protocol (IP) network include receiving, at a signal transfer point, a first SS7 user part message. The first SS7 user part message can be ... | 11/23/2010 |
| 7814015 | Methods and systems for performing a sales transaction using a mobile communications device Methods and systems for performing sales transactions using a mobile communications device and without requiring text messaging or paging services are disclosed. In one example, a subscriber desiring to purchase goods or services proceeds to a point of sale device w... | 10/12/2010 |
| 7804789 | Methods, systems, and computer program products for organizing, managing, and selectively distributing routing information in a signaling message routing node Methods, systems, and computer program products for managing and selectively distributing routing information in a routing node are disclosed. In one implementation, a method for selectively distributing routing information in a routing node includes organizing inte... | 09/28/2010 |
| 7801093 | Signal transfer point with wireless signaling link interface An STP includes a link interface module for performing SS7 signal transfer functions, such as routing messages between SS7 signaling points. A WLAN signaling link interface is operatively associated with the link interface module for sending and receiving SS7 signal... | 09/21/2010 |
| 7787445 | Methods, systems, and computer program products for routing and processing ENUM queries The subject matter described herein includes methods, systems, and computer program products for routing ENUM queries to an ENUM database. According to one aspect, the subject matter described herein includes a method for routing ENUM queries to an ENUM database. Th... | 08/31/2010 |
| 7774849 | Methods, systems, and computer program products for detecting and mitigating denial of service attacks in a telecommunications signaling network Methods, systems, and computer program products for detecting and mitigating a denial of service attack in a telecommunications signaling network are provided. According to one method, traffic rate information is monitored on at least two of a plurality of signaling... | 08/10/2010 |